1. Enhancing Oral Health Through Implants

Dental implants play a crucial role in transforming oral health, particularly for individuals who have lost teeth. Unlike traditional dentures or bridges, dental implants replace the root of the missing tooth, providing a sturdy base for artificial teeth. This feature helps to maintain jawbone integrity by preventing bone resorption, which is a common consequence of tooth loss. Over time, a preserved jawbone contributes to the overall structure and support of the face.
Moreover, dental implants are designed to function similarly to natural teeth, allowing patients to enjoy a greater variety of foods without dietary restrictions. Individuals equipped with implants can chew more effectively, leading to improved nutrition and digestion. This benefit not only enhances oral health but also positively affects overall health, aligning with the principle that good nutrition is foundational for maintaining robust well-being.
As part of a comprehensive oral care strategy, dental implants can also facilitate better oral hygiene. Patients can maintain their oral hygiene routines without the complexity that often accompanies removable dentures. With proper care, implants can last many years, significantly reducing the chances of further dental complications.
2. Psychological Benefits of Dental Implants
The impact of dental implants extends beyond physical health into the realm of psychological well-being. One of the most notable benefits is the boost in self-esteem and confidence that many individuals experience after receiving dental implants. A complete smile restores a persons ability to communicate and engage socially, reducing feelings of embarrassment often associated with tooth loss.
Additionally, the permanence of dental implants provides peace of mind to users. Unlike removable dentures, which can shift or fall out, implants remain securely anchored in the jaw. This stability not only elevates confidence in social situations but also lessens anxiety related to oral health and appearance.
Furthermore, studies have shown that individuals with improved dental aesthetics are more likely to participate in social activities, which positively affects mental health. Engaging more confidently in social interactions can lead to enriched personal relationships and improved overall happiness.

4. Innovations in Dental Implant Technology
The field of dental implant treatment has seen remarkable innovations that enhance the effectiveness and efficiency of the procedure. Recent advancements in materials, such as titanium and zirconia, have improved biocompatibility and longevity. These materials significantly reduce the risk of implant rejection or complications.
Additionally, technology such as 3D imaging and computer-guided surgery has revolutionized the planning and placement of implants. These innovations allow for precise placement, reducing the need for extensive invasive procedures and leading to faster recovery times. The more accurate these procedures are, the higher the success rates for implants.
Incorporating artificial intelligence (AI) into implant planning and patient simulations is also a breakthrough in the field. AI can predict outcomes based on individual patient factors, leading to highly personalized treatment plans that improve the overall success of the implant. As these technologies continue to evolve, they promise even greater achievements in enhancing dental care and patient results.
